In honor of Earth Day, members of EcoLogic, Rensselaer’s environmental student organization, plans to host the annual EarthFest on Friday, April 24, from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. on the Rensselaer Union patio.

The event is free and open to the public. This year, EarthFest will feature information and displays from several student organizations and local environmental groups, food, and more. Signature EarthFest offerings include: free smoothies, tie-dying, paint-a-pot, pot-a-plant, and recycled make-your-own notebooks.

To date, Habitat for Humanity, the Student Sustainability Task Force, Design for America at Rensselaer, Society of Environmental Professionals, Terra Café, Energy, and Environment—The Vasudha Living & Learning Community, and SustainAffinity, will participate in this year’s event. Diana Ahrens, who serves as president for EcoLogic, noted that the group has also invited additional environmental and volunteer-focused clubs to participate.

EarthFest is part of a series of Rensselaer programs and events planned for the week of April 20 in celebration of Earth Week.
